Responsibilities

  • Follow a layout to place computer-generated vinyl or full color graphic images on a pre-determined substrate or medium.
  • Prepare substrates for application, which may include cutting, painting, laminating, cleaning, and maintaining the substrates for vinyl application.
  • Weeds excess vinyl from computer cut images
  • Performs quality assurance measures pre- and post-production.
  • Performs finishing operations such as laminating, encapsulating, and mounting of printed pieces
  • Reports inventory levels and stock to be ordered
  • Helps unload raw materials and cleans and maintains storage areas.
  • Performs routine machine maintenance and minor repairs when necessary.
  • Installs signs as necessary
  • Loads material on/into printer and or laminator which may require some heaving lifting.
  • Maintains all equipment including computers, plotters, and printers (water-soluble prints, thermal transfer printers, etc.)
  • Additional requirements include cutting printed graphics using a variety of wall cutters, saws, and Exacto blades; and building interiors and exteriors using a ladder or mechanical lift system. Careful attention to detail utilizing work orders that outline specifics for each custom order is paramount.
